The story of this jar

Energy Honey is built for the morning shift: purified shilajit from the mountains, Panax ginseng, bee pollen from our own hives, ground khajoor and Ceylon cinnamon with ashwagandha root, all in light raw honey.

This is the jar our gym customers and 6 a.m. commuters reorder. It is intense — mineral, malty, unmistakably herbal. If you want honey that tastes like dessert, choose Acacia or Orange Blossom; if you want the jar that starts the engine, this is it.

What does shilajit with honey do?

Shilajit is the subcontinent’s traditional mineral tonic and honey its traditional carrier. Together with ginseng, pollen and dates it makes the classic morning-vitality spoon. Food, not medicine.

Is the shilajit genuine?

Yes — purified, filtered resin, lab-checked. Raw unpurified shilajit is unsafe; ours is processed the correct traditional-plus-modern way.

What does it taste like?

Strong: malty, mineral and herbal over light honey with a cinnamon finish. It is the boldest-tasting jar we make.

Who should avoid it?

Pregnant or nursing women and anyone on regular medication should check with a doctor first — ginseng and shilajit are potent traditional ingredients.
